本文目录导读:
在当今这个信息化时代,服务器流量已经成为衡量企业IT基础设施健康状况的重要指标,随着企业业务的不断发展,服务器流量也在不断增加,这对服务器的性能和稳定性提出了更高的要求,作为评测编程专家,我们需要关注服务器流量的评测与优化策略,以确保企业的信息系统能够高效、稳定地运行。
服务器流量评测方法
1、基于监控工具的评测
通过部署监控工具(如Zabbix、Nagios等),实时收集服务器的流量数据,包括CPU使用率、内存使用率、网络吞吐量等,通过对这些数据的分析,可以评估服务器的性能状况,监控工具还可以自动发现潜在的问题,并生成报警信息,帮助运维人员及时处理问题。
2、基于日志分析的评测
收集服务器的访问日志、操作日志等数据,通过日志分析工具(如ELK、Splunk等)进行大数据分析,通过对日志数据的挖掘,可以发现异常访问行为、热点资源分布等信息,从而评估服务器的流量状况,日志分析还可以辅助安全团队发现潜在的安全威胁。
3、基于压力测试的评测
通过压力测试工具(如JMeter、LoadRunner等),模拟大量用户并发访问服务器,测试服务器在高负载情况下的性能表现,压力测试可以帮助我们发现服务器的瓶颈,从而制定针对性的优化策略。
服务器流量优化策略
1、优化代码和数据库
对于服务器上的应用程序和数据库,可以通过优化代码、调整配置参数等方式提高其性能,减少不必要的计算和内存分配,使用缓存技术降低数据库查询的压力等。
2、采用负载均衡技术
通过负载均衡技术(如硬件负载均衡、软件负载均衡等),将流量分散到多个服务器上,降低单个服务器的压力,这样可以提高服务器的吞吐量,保证系统的稳定运行。
3、使用CDN加速服务
分发网络(CDN)是一种将静态资源分发到离用户更近的服务器上的技术,通过使用CDN加速服务,可以减轻源服务器的压力,提高用户访问速度,特别是对于视频、图片等大文件的传输,CDN加速效果更为明显。4、限制用户访问速率
对于一些消耗资源较多的应用程序,可以限制用户的访问速率,避免因过多的请求导致服务器崩溃,可以设置每个用户的请求速率上限,超过上限的用户将被暂时或永久封禁。
5、定期进行系统维护和更新
为了保持服务器的良好状态,需要定期进行系统维护和更新,清理无用文件、升级操作系统和软件版本等,这有助于提高服务器的性能,降低故障发生的风险。
作为评测编程专家,我们需要关注服务器流量的评测与优化策略,以确保企业的信息系统能够高效、稳定地运行,通过对服务器流量的持续关注和优化,我们可以为企业创造更大的价值。